About The Glacier County Historical Museum offers educational, interactive and interesting exhibits on homesteading, Lewis & Clark, the artist John Clark, community businesses, oil, and Cut Bank 1898 through the 1960s. This 14-acre site includes two museum exhibit buildings, an oil worker's house, oil derrick, 1917 schoolhouse, 1980s caboose, and - our most recent addition - a replica homestead house and farm interpreted by living history.
